Definition of Intermediates


In pharmaceutical chemistry, intermediates refer to the compounds that are formed during the synthesis of pharmaceuticals before they are converted into the final active pharmaceutical ingredient (API). These substances act as stepping stones in the multi-stage synthesis process, where a series of chemical reactions lead to the creation of an API. Understanding these intermediates is crucial, as they not only help streamline production but also play a significant role in the quality and consistency of the final product.


Role in Drug Development


The drug development process is intricate and involves a multitude of phases, including discovery, preclinical testing, clinical trials, and regulatory approvals. Intermediates are critical during the early stages of drug development, particularly in the design phase where chemists explore various synthetic routes to arrive at an effective API. By studying the properties and reactions of potential intermediates, researchers can make informed decisions about which pathways may lead to the most promising candidates for drugs.


Moreover, intermediates can influence the pharmacokinetics and pharmacodynamics of the final drug. Certain intermediates might exhibit specific biological activities or toxicity, providing valuable insights into optimizing the drug's profile before it reaches clinical testing. This vigilance in the early stages can significantly mitigate risks later in the development process.

The process of synthesizing pharmaceuticals involves rigorous quality control measures to ensure that all intermediates meet necessary standards. Regulatory agencies, such as the FDA and EMA, require pharmaceutical companies to provide detailed information regarding the intermediates used in drug production, including their sources, synthesis methods, and purity levels. This ensures that every component of the drug creation process adheres to the strict guidelines set out for safety and efficacy.


Furthermore, the identity, strength, quality, and purity of intermediates must be well-documented and validated to comply with Good Manufacturing Practices (GMP). This compliance not only protects patient safety but also safeguards pharmaceutical manufacturers from potential legal liabilities that arise from contaminated or ineffective drugs.


Challenges in Handling Intermediates


Despite their significance, intermediates pose several challenges for pharmaceutical companies. The development of a new synthetic route to create intermediates can be a time-consuming and costly process involving extensive experimentation and optimization. Additionally, the stability and handling of these intermediates must be carefully monitored to avoid degradation or unexpected reactions that could compromise the final product.


Moreover, the use of intermediates derived from natural sources may introduce variability due to differences in quality and availability. Therefore, establishing a reliable supply chain for intermediates can be a logistical challenge which also requires strategic planning and relationships with suppliers.
